All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Marshfield Street area has the 24th highest crime rate of 113 local areas in Alway , and the 103rd highest crime rate of 517 local areas in Newport .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Marshfield Street (NP19 0GY) in the last 12 months was 174.6 per 1,000 residents and was 55.1% higher than the Alway average (112.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 14 offences recorded. The least common crime was Vehicle crime with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-58.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 20 (≈ 79.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-37.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-21.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Marshfield Street (NP19 0GY), the main crime hotspot is near St Andrews Place. Police recorded 97 crimes here, including 32 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
